I have fairly oily skin and need aftershaves that don't clash with my collection of fragrances. I prefer alcohol based splashes, but I'm open to lotions/balms as well (if they don't leave an oily film).
I remember the following:
Nivea Sensitive/Original Balm: Great for the winter, but too oily otherwise.
Nivea Lotion: Even stickier than the balm.
Nivea Splash (silver, alcohol based): Workable for fall, but still too oily. Don't like the scent.
Proraso Green: A little bit better than the Niveas, but still too greasy. Scent strength acceptable.
Brut: Too oily. Don't like the scent.
Thayers Witch Hazel: Too oily. Don't like the scent.
Shiseido Bravas: Great! but scent too strong.
Various cologne aftershaves: Some very good (Baldessarini etc), but scent too strong.
Mandom (unscented, alcohol): Greasier than most balms.
There was a period when I just splashed vodka on my face, but I've become more sensible since
